Catalog description

This course applies economic principles and concepts to health policy issues including the demand and production of health services, health care costs, and healthcare markets. Specific topics include, physicians service industry, hospitals service industry, pharmaceutical industry and long-term care industries. The course also covers briefly economic evaluation methods such as cost-benefit analysis, cost-effectiveness, and cost-utility analysis. Issues associated with the Affordable Care Act (ACA) and other healthcare policy regulations are emphasized throughout the course.
